There are a few off the shelf but NOTHING are complex as purestorm, net-model etc etc, they are custom code jobs.

Expect to pay around ?60-80 an hour for a professional php/asp coder who is skilled enough to pull off something like that.

Remember that its is querying a database so you need some pretty efficient SQL using there otherwise you will skill your database. So you have to pay the price.

You will also need a very optimised sturctured database as well, to keep it under control.

I was quoted by an indian contractor ?3000 and was quoted 8000 by a UK company.

Alot of people have customised personal's script into model sites, and other have done mash ups of a few different programs (like Be Seen Here) that have worked well too.

Just make sure you know what buying, because coding like anything else most people can do it, but very few can do it well.

Your perfect example is bluebird, all the money in the world but their webmasters fucked up royally, its sooooo very easy to do.

It would explain why net-model, one model place, purestorm at the only real ones to have a dedicated system in place, and almost everyone else uses altered scripts that was designed to A but now modded to do B.

So for me, take care in what you pay for and then make a good go at it and i'm happy :)


p.s. Save yourself a whole heap of hassle and tell them you want use mod_rewrite for addresses. This means you can put

mydomain.com/carole

in and the webserver see's it as

mydomain.com/models/profiles.ext?referer=&model=carole

or

mydomain.com/models/profiles.ext?referer=&model=3829424

and you want it done with object orientated templates where the code and style are separate like phpnuke / phpbb and stuff like that.

This will save you MEGA money when you come to upgrade, add alter and adjust things :)
